Python++in用法指的是Python中通過(guò)“++in”這個(gè)標(biāo)志來(lái)表示步長(zhǎng)的概念,這在一些循環(huán)語(yǔ)句中非常有用。
# 舉一個(gè)簡(jiǎn)單的例子 for i in range(0, 10, 2): print(i) # 代碼輸出結(jié)果為: # 0 # 2 # 4 # 6 # 8
上述代碼中,使用了Python++in用法通過(guò)步長(zhǎng)為2的方式循環(huán)輸出0-10之間的所有偶數(shù)。
使用Python++in用法的語(yǔ)法如下:
range(start, stop[, step])
其中start表示循環(huán)的起始值,stop表示循環(huán)終止的值(不包括stop本身),step則表示循環(huán)的步長(zhǎng),默認(rèn)為1。
需要注意的是,使用Python++in用法時(shí),步長(zhǎng)必須是整數(shù),否則會(huì)報(bào)錯(cuò)。
總結(jié)來(lái)說(shuō),Python++in用法可以大大簡(jiǎn)化一些循環(huán)語(yǔ)句的代碼,使得程序更加簡(jiǎn)潔、高效。